Why Porcelain Tile Works for the Urban Rustic Look
Porcelain tile stands out as a flooring material because it balances visual authenticity with practical performance. Unlike natural stone, which can be porous and prone to staining, porcelain is fired at extremely high temperatures that fuse the clay body into a dense, waterproof material. This manufacturing process creates a surface that resists scratches, stains, and moisture absorption at a rate below 0.5 percent, making it one of the most durable flooring options available.
The urban rustic style relies on materials that appear raw and unrefined yet perform like modern products. Porcelain tile manufacturers have responded to this demand by developing collections that closely mimic weathered concrete, reclaimed stone, and even aged metal. Through-body porcelain, where the color and pattern extend through the entire thickness of the tile, ensures that chips and wear at the edges do not reveal a different color underneath. The result is a floor that reads as authentic and textured but cleans up with a simple damp mop. Choosing Colors and Textures for a Cohesive Home
One of the strongest arguments for using porcelain tile throughout a home is the ability to maintain visual consistency across different rooms while varying the color to suit each space. Many manufacturers produce coordinated collections that include multiple colorways of the same tile profile. This allows homeowners to select a lighter shade for open living areas and a darker tone for private spaces like bathrooms or studies without introducing a jarring change in texture or format.
Surface texture deserves as much attention as color. Tiles with a slightly rough finish, sometimes described as matte or sueded, reduce the risk of slips, especially in areas that get wet. The coefficient of friction rating on porcelain tiles varies significantly between polished and textured finishes, and building codes in many regions require a minimum slip resistance for bathroom and entryway flooring. Glossy tiles, while attractive, can become hazardous when moisture is present. The best urban rustic floors use tiles that look unpolished and natural while providing a tactile grip underfoot. Subfloor Preparation and Underlayment Choices
A successful tile installation begins with a properly prepared subfloor. Porcelain tile is rigid and does not flex, so any movement in the floor assembly below will transfer directly to the tile, causing cracks or loose grout over time. The subfloor must be clean, level, and structurally sound before any underlayment goes down. Deflection in the joist system should not exceed L/360, meaning the floor can only bend 1/360th of its span under a uniform load.
Cement backerboard remains the industry standard for tile underlayment. Modern formulations are lighter than traditional versions, making them easier to cut and handle on site. They provide a stable base that resists moisture and prevents the tile installation from bonding directly to the wood subfloor, which can expand and contract with seasonal humidity changes. Some newer glass-mat backerboard products offer enhanced moisture resistance for wet areas such as shower enclosures, while uncoupling membranes provide an additional layer of protection against substrate movement. - Inspect the subfloor for flatness. A variation of more than 1/4 inch over 10 feet requires self-leveling compound before tiling begins.
- Install cement backerboard with corrosion-resistant screws at 6-inch intervals along edges and 8-inch intervals in the field of each board.
- Seam all backerboard joints with alkali-resistant fiberglass tape embedded in thin-set mortar to prevent cracking at panel seams.
- Allow the underlayment assembly to cure for at least 24 hours before beginning tile layout and cutting.
Grout, Thinset, and Installation Best Practices
The performance of a tile floor depends heavily on the materials used between and beneath the tiles. Thinset mortar provides the bond that holds each tile in place, while grout fills the joints and protects the edges of the tile from moisture and debris. Choosing the right products for each location makes a significant difference in the longevity of the installation, and manufacturers provide detailed specifications for coverage, cure time, and acceptable temperature ranges during installation.
For thinset, modified mortars that include polymers offer superior adhesion to both the backerboard and the tile body. Unmodified thinset is generally reserved for installations that will be submerged, such as shower floors, where polymers could soften through prolonged water exposure. Grout comes in sanded and unsanded varieties. Sanded grout is required for joints wider than 1/8 inch because the sand particles prevent the grout from shrinking and cracking as it cures. Unsanded grout works best for narrow joints typically found with rectified tiles. Epoxy grout provides the highest stain and chemical resistance and is an excellent choice for kitchen floors where cooking spills and acidic foods are common. Shower Tile Planning and Accent Details
Tile selection for shower enclosures demands attention to both aesthetics and function. The floor of a shower needs small-format tiles such as hexagons or mosaics because the many grout lines provide traction and allow the floor to slope properly toward the drain at a minimum pitch of 1/4 inch per foot. Larger tiles in a shower pan can create ponding issues and feel slippery underfoot. Hexagon tiles in particular have a long history in wet areas because their shape distributes load evenly and the multiple grout lines create natural drainage channels.
Ceilings in showers benefit from tile coverage as well. Drywall ceilings in steamy shower environments tend to peel and flake over time as moisture works its way through paint layers and into the gypsum core. Tiling the ceiling solves this moisture problem permanently and also creates a distinct visual boundary that makes the shower feel like a deliberate, crafted space rather than an afterthought. The tile pattern on the ceiling can echo or contrast with the wall layout to add visual interest without requiring additional materials. Accent tiles, used sparingly inside niches or around shower controls, add personality without overwhelming the overall design. Glass tile accents in particular catch light and add depth, appearing to change color depending on the viewing angle and lighting conditions. Long-Term Care for Porcelain Tile Floors
Porcelain tile requires less maintenance than many other flooring materials, but some care is still necessary to preserve its appearance over decades of use. Regular sweeping or vacuuming removes abrasive grit that can scratch even the hardest tile surfaces over time. Damp mopping with clean water and a neutral pH cleaner is sufficient for most spills and daily soil accumulation. Abrasive cleaners, steel wool, and acidic solutions should never be used on porcelain tile because they can dull the glaze or etch the surface.
- Daily care: Sweep or dust mop to remove loose dirt and grit that can scratch tile surfaces over time.
- Weekly cleaning: Damp mop using a pH-neutral tile cleaner. Avoid vinegar, bleach, or ammonia-based products that can damage grout.
- Monthly inspection: Examine grout lines for cracks, voids, or discoloration and reseal if necessary.
- Annual deep clean: Scrub grout lines with a stiff brush and grout-specific cleaner. Reapply penetrating grout sealer in high-moisture areas.
Grout is the most vulnerable part of any tile installation. Even with proper sealing, grout lines can discolor over time from embedded dirt and mildew growth in damp environments. Keeping grout clean and sealed extends the life of the entire floor assembly. When resealing, apply a penetrating sealer that bonds chemically with the cementitious grout rather than a surface coating that can peel, yellow, or trap moisture beneath it.
